| ---
|  net/dccp/proto.c |   11 +++--------
|  1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
| 
| diff --git a/net/dccp/proto.c b/net/dccp/proto.c
| index b03ecf6..f79bcef 100644
| --- a/net/dccp/proto.c
| +++ b/net/dccp/proto.c
| @@ -473,14 +473,9 @@ static int dccp_setsockopt_ccid(struct sock *sk, int type,
|  	if (optlen < 1 || optlen > DCCP_FEAT_MAX_SP_VALS)
|  		return -EINVAL;
|  
| -	val = kmalloc(optlen, GFP_KERNEL);
| -	if (val == NULL)
| -		return -ENOMEM;
| -
| -	if (copy_from_user(val, optval, optlen)) {
| -		kfree(val);
| -		return -EFAULT;
| -	}
| +	val = memdup_user(optval, optlen);
| +	if (IS_ERR(val))
| +		return PTR_ERR(val);
|  
|  	lock_sock(sk);
|  	if (type == DCCP_SOCKOPT_TX_CCID || type == DCCP_SOCKOPT_CCID)
